Louisa’s 3 Blush Review
At their first meeting, Poppy asked Zach to be her pretend boy (her ex and new girlfriend show up). Poppy is beautiful and he is totally on board from the moment she asks.
Poppy hasn’t had an easy life, but she’s not complaining. She’s working hard to achieve her goals while overcoming a few obstacles.
Zach is an advisor at the college, helping students like Poppy. Of course, they probably shouldn’t hook up. He’s not her teacher but there is a little bit of forbidden going on.
Poppy’s friends (who are hilarious) and Zach’s mom were two characters who made me enjoy this book even more.
I think the back and forth and push a pull went a little longer than I would have liked, they protested a little too much and too long for me. But I do have to say this – once they decided to “go for it”, I was so happy. I loved Zach’s devotion to Poppy and her life and he may have made me swoon a time or two.
A New York Times, Wall Street Journal, and USA Today bestselling author of more than two dozen titles, Kendall Ryan has sold over 1.5 million books and her books have been translated into several languages in countries around the world. She’s a traditionally published author with Simon & Schuster and Harper Collins UK, as well as an independently published author. Since she first began self-publishing in 2012, she’s appeared at #1 on Barnes & Noble and iBooks charts around the world. Her books have also appeared on the New York Times and USA Today bestseller lists more than three dozen times. Ryan has been featured in such publications as USA Today, Newsweek, and InTouch Magazine.
